Transaction 035db84fa6278fb910422f8082285aebb77a9214f9630715cefcf5039f23cd65
1 Input
1 Output
-
035db84fa6278fb910422f8082285aebb77a9214f9630715cefcf5039f23cd65:0
- value
- 80615
- script pubkey
- OP_0 OP_PUSHBYTES_20 dc84cbce6578e13c8fb2d9a3ed0ecbcb0894505c
- address
- bc1qmjzvhnn90rsnerajmx376rktevyfg5zup6yaw9